Shop
Showing 2561–2592 of 3879 resultsSorted by latest
-
Original price was: £175.00.£122.00Current price is: £122.00.
Only 1 left in stock
Showing 2561–2592 of 3879 resultsSorted by latest
Showing 2561–2592 of 3879 resultsSorted by latest
Only 1 left in stock
Showing 2561–2592 of 3879 resultsSorted by latest